Controls Engineer – MES & Manufacturing Automation

North Point TechnologyNovi, MI

About The Position

North Point Technology is seeking an experienced MES Controls Engineer to support manufacturing operations in a high-volume discrete manufacturing environment. This role focuses on Manufacturing Execution Systems (MES), PLC integration, real-time production execution, and automation system reliability. The ideal candidate will work closely with engineering, operations, and production teams to support and optimize MES-driven manufacturing processes.

Responsibilities

  • Support MES-to-PLC integrations during system launches, production ramp-ups, and ongoing manufacturing operations.
  • Configure, establish, and maintain communications between MES and PLC systems.
  • Integrate MES template routines and user-defined data types (UDTs) into PLC programs.
  • Create, modify, and maintain PLC tags and logic required to support MES transactions and production reporting.
  • Collaborate with Process Engineers and MES teams to ensure successful integration of manufacturing processes.
  • Document MES-related PLC modifications, troubleshooting activities, and production support efforts.
  • Troubleshoot PLC, HMI, and industrial network issues impacting MES functionality and production execution.
  • Support the accuracy and integrity of real-time production reporting and manufacturing data.
  • Assist in resolving production issues affecting throughput, efficiency, quality, and system performance.
  • Partner with production supervisors, operators, and engineering teams to support effective manufacturing workflows.
  • Support MES-based quality validation and enforcement processes.
  • Maintain and manage part numbers, product structures, and production data within the MES environment.
  • Assist with audits, investigations, root cause analysis, and manufacturing data requests.
  • Identify opportunities to improve MES functionality, automation performance, and manufacturing processes.
  • Support MES enhancements, software updates, system upgrades, and new production rollouts.
